Baby and child-specific products will fail to see any perceptible growth in retail constant value (2022 prices) terms of during the forecast period, thanks to the country’s low birth rate. At present, there is no national policy in place to support an increase in the fertility rate, and Spanish women are therefore likely to keep postponing the age at which they become mothers and also reduce the number of children they want to have.
During the forecast period, children are expected to have more influence in day-to-day purchasing decisions and this is likely to extend to the products they use in their personal hygiene routines. This will be supported by new parenting trends that support the greater freedom of children to make their own choices, in order to develop their personalities.
During the forecast period, manufacturers will increasingly seek to launch more licensed products featuring brands from popular TV series, such as Stranger Things, Wednesday or Matilda (all Netflix), as well as looking to reach children and their parents via YouTube or TikTok. YouTube channel Las Ratitas, for example, has some 25 million subscribers.
